Kasino: Definition and Pharmacological Classification

Kasino is a powerful, prescription-only medication whose active ingredient, Amikacin sulfate, classifies it as an aminoglycoside antibiotic. This medicine is specifically utilized in institutional settings for the short-term treatment of serious bacterial infections. The drug belongs to the aminoglycoside class of antibiotics, a category designated for its potent activity against specific, often challenging bacteria. As a semi-synthetic compound, Amikacin is chemically derived from the naturally occurring kanamycin, a modification that is clinically recognized for conferring greater stability and efficacy against many bacterial enzymes compared to older drugs in its class.

Amikacin's core mechanism involves the inhibition of bacterial protein synthesis, serving as a decisive, fast-acting agent against bacteria. Kasino is a single-ingredient product, and its classification as an aminoglycoside places it among the systemic antibacterials used when initial, less potent treatments are insufficient, particularly in a hospital environment where antibiotic resistance is a significant concern.


Composition, Form, and General Purpose

Kasino is supplied for parenteral administration—meaning it must be administered by injection—typically as a sterile solution for injection or a powder intended for reconstitution. This preparation method ensures that the drug is delivered reliably and quickly into the bloodstream, achieving the high concentration levels required to combat severe systemic infections. A typical use scenario involves the management of complicated hospital-acquired pneumonia when the causative bacteria are suspected to be resistant to first-line agents.

The general purpose of the medicine is to apply a decisive bactericidal action—meaning it actively kills the target microorganisms—to achieve the prompt eradication of overwhelming bacterial populations. Amikacin is categorized as a reserve antibiotic for the treatment of drug-resistant tuberculosis and other severe infections. By directly interfering with the bacteria’s vital protein assembly, Kasino acts as an essential broad-spectrum tool to help the body recover from severe bacterial attacks.

What side effects are possible with Kasino?

Official Safety Profile of Kasino (Amikacin Sulfate)

The official regulatory safety profile for Kasino (Amikacin sulfate) is structured around potential toxicities to specific organ systems, as documented by government regulatory authorities (e.g., FDA, EMA). This profile emphasizes two primary, dose- and duration-related safety concerns.


Adverse Reaction Scope

Key Adverse Reaction Categories: The primary documented risks are Nephrotoxicity (kidney damage) and Neurotoxicity, which includes Ototoxicity (damage to the eighth cranial nerve affecting hearing and balance) and Neuromuscular Blockade (potential for muscular paralysis).

System-Organ Classes Involved: Adverse reactions are grouped in regulatory texts under Renal and Urinary Disorders (e.g., increased serum creatinine, acute renal failure), Ear and Labyrinth Disorders (e.g., hearing loss, vertigo, tinnitus), and Nervous System Disorders (e.g., tremor, paresthesia, convulsions).

Commonly Documented Adverse Reactions (by frequency):

  • Common: Nephrotoxicity (changes in renal function, often reversible upon discontinuation).
  • Rare: Irreversible hearing loss, acute renal failure, hypotension, Macular infarction leading to permanent vision loss, and certain blood disorders (anemia, eosinophilia).

Serious Adverse Reactions and Restrictions

Serious Adverse Reactions (as documented): The regulatory labeling specifically highlights the potential for total or partial irreversible bilateral deafness, acute renal failure, and respiratory paralysis due to neuromuscular blockade.

Population-Specific Safety Considerations:

  • Patients with Impaired Renal Function: Officially noted to be at a greater risk of developing toxicity.
  • Older Adults: Increased risk of toxicity due to potential subclinical reduction in renal function.
  • Pregnancy: The drug can cause fetal harm, including the potential for irreversible congenital deafness in the exposed child.

Dose- or Exposure-Related Patterns: The risk of toxicity is officially documented as increasing with prolonged therapy (e.g., beyond 7 to 10–14 days) or a high total cumulative dose. Auditory damage may become manifest and irreversible even after the medicine has been discontinued.

Safety-Related Restrictions: The medication is contraindicated in individuals with known hypersensitivity to any aminoglycoside. Caution is required in patients with conditions like Myasthenia Gravis and when used concurrently with other agents known to cause ototoxicity or nephrotoxicity.

Overdose and Emergency Response

Overdose and When to Seek Help

The official regulatory documentation for Kasino (Amikacin sulfate) strictly defines overdose manifestations and the necessary emergency response.

Documented Overdose Manifestations

Overdose is primarily characterized by two areas of acute systemic toxicity. Nephrotoxicity presents as acute renal impairment, indicated by elevated serum creatinine and changes in urine output. Ototoxicity involves damage to the inner ear, potentially resulting in tinnitus, dizziness, vertigo, and irreversible hearing loss. The most severe documented manifestation is acute neuromuscular blockade, leading to profound muscle weakness and potentially respiratory paralysis or arrest.

Required Emergency Actions

Immediate medical attention must be sought if any signs of severe toxicity, especially those indicating breathing difficulty or respiratory compromise, are observed. Hospital monitoring is required in all suspected overdose cases. Treatment is defined as symptomatic and supportive. Regulatory documents note that hemodialysis may be effective for removing the drug from the bloodstream in severe cases, and calcium salts may be administered to attempt to reverse acute neuromuscular blockade. No specific chemical antidote is known. The risk of toxicity is documented as higher in patients with pre-existing renal impairment and in the elderly.

Therapeutic Uses of Kasino

What Kasino Treats: Main Uses and Benefits

Kasino (Amikacin sulfate) is a prescription medication, commonly reserved for managing serious bacterial infections applied in clinical settings that involve acute or unstable symptom patterns. Its use is generally limited to situations where conditions are marked by increased physiological stress or are caused by difficult-to-treat organisms.

Amikacin is commonly used in the treatment of serious infections, including bacterial septicemia, infections of the respiratory tract, bones and joints, and the central nervous system.

The medication is a relevant therapeutic option when symptoms are driven by highly resilient pathogens, including conditions involving multi-drug resistant bacteria. This use provides support that helps ease the overall symptom burden in challenging situations.

Eligibility and Restrictions for Use

Who Can and Cannot Use Kasino?

The eligibility for using Kasino (Amikacin sulfate) is strictly defined by regulatory authorities based on a patient's existing health status and age.


Contraindicated Populations (Must Not Use)

Kasino is formally contraindicated in patients with a known allergy to Amikacin, other aminoglycoside antibiotics (due to the risk of cross-sensitivity), or to sulfites present in the formulation.


Populations Requiring Restricted Use and Monitoring

Use is highly restricted and requires close medical oversight for certain groups:

  • Impaired Renal Function: Patients with known or suspected poor kidney function must be treated with caution and require rigorous monitoring and dose adjustment. Administration of the total daily dose in a single injection is not recommended if kidney function is significantly impaired.
  • Neuromuscular Conditions: Individuals with disorders such as Myasthenia Gravis or Parkinsonism should use Kasino with caution as it may aggravate muscle weakness.
  • Treatment Duration: The drug's safety for treatment periods longer than 14 days is not established in the regulatory labeling.

Age- and Condition-Related Eligibility

  • Age Groups: The medicine is approved for adults, adolescents, and children (four weeks and older). Enhanced caution and monitoring are necessary for neonates (due to immature renal function) and older adults (due to the likelihood of subclinical renal impairment).
  • Pregnancy and Lactation: Kasino is generally not recommended during pregnancy due to documented risks (often cited as a Category D drug). The label recommends discontinuing the drug or breastfeeding during treatment.

What should I know about interactions with other medicines?

Interactions with other medicines and products

The official interaction profile for Kasino (Amikacin sulfate) is defined by its potential for additive toxicity and specific pharmacokinetic effects, as documented in government regulatory labeling.

Documented Interaction Constraints

Classification Interacting Agents (Examples) Official Regulatory Basis
Contraindicated Amphotericin B deoxycholate, Cidofovir, Oral Neomycin Prohibited due to documented risk of synergistic nephrotoxicity and ototoxicity.
Avoid/Caution Potent Diuretics (e.g., Furosemide), other Nephrotoxic Products (e.g., Vancomycin, Cisplatin) Use must be avoided due to the potential for additive ototoxicity or enhancement of toxicity by altering drug concentrations.

Pharmacodynamic and Administration Rules

Kasino may potentiate the effect of neuromuscular blocking agents (e.g., succinylcholine, tubocurarine), which carries a documented risk of neuromuscular blockade and respiratory paralysis. Furthermore, the combination with live bacterial vaccines (e.g., BCG, Cholera) requires administration timing separation due to the potential for pharmacodynamic antagonism.

Pharmacokinetic interactions include the documented effect of Quinidine, which may increase Kasino plasma levels via the P-glycoprotein efflux transporter. Regulatory guidance also notes that interaction risk is amplified in populations with Advanced Age and Dehydration.

Mechanism of Action

How Kasino Works

Kasino's active ingredient, Amikacin sulfate, operates through a distinct, specific mechanism that targets the bacterial cell's essential process for cellular function. The following sections detail the molecular targets, the resulting cascade of cellular destruction, and the inherent limits of this mechanism.


Molecular Blockade of Protein Synthesis

The drug's primary action is the irreversible binding to the bacterial 30S ribosomal subunit. This molecular intervention directly prevents the ribosome from correctly reading the messenger RNA (mRNA) genetic code, which is essential for assembling proteins. The resulting physiological effect is a cascade of mistranslation, forcing the bacterium to manufacture non-functional and toxic proteins.


Causal Cascade and Bactericidal Action

The production of these defective proteins leads to widespread cellular toxicity, including the disruption of the cell membrane's integrity and the failure of critical internal enzymes. This damage quickly results in a bactericidal action, meaning the mechanism actively kills the target microorganisms. The efficiency of this process is strongly characterized by concentration-dependent killing, where the rate of bacterial destruction increases with increased local drug concentrations.


️ Mechanistic Constraint by Oxygen Dependence

A key constraint of Amikacin's mechanism is its reliance on the bacteria's own metabolism for entry: the drug must be actively transported across the bacterial cell membrane via an oxygen-dependent process. This makes the drug's mechanism less effective against certain bacteria, such as obligate anaerobes, which lack the required oxygen-based metabolism, or in deep-tissue environments where oxygen levels are low.

Dosage and Administration Information

How Kasino (Amikacin Sulfate) is Used: Official Administration Guidelines

Kasino is administered through parenteral routes, typically as an intravenous (IV) infusion or an intramuscular (IM) injection. Use as a localized irrigating solution in specific body cavities is also utilized in clinical settings. The administration protocol is precise and generally restricted to a short duration.

Standard Dosing and Frequency

The total daily dose for adults and children with normal kidney function is 15 mg/kg/day, calculated based on the patient's body weight. This total dose is commonly divided and administered as 7.5 mg/kg every 12 hours or 5 mg/kg every 8 hours. In many cases, the total daily dose may be given as a single daily dose, but certain high-risk clinical scenarios, such as endocarditis, require twice-daily dosing.

Dosing Principle Official Guideline
Total Daily Dose 15 mg/kg/day based on weight
Maximum Daily Dose Must not exceed 1.5 grams
Typical Duration Limited to 7 to 10 days

Administration Requirements

For IV infusion, the dose must be diluted in a compatible sterile solution, such as normal saline, and administered slowly over a period of 30 to 60 minutes in adults. The medicine is intended for short-term use, and the duration of therapy is typically limited to 10 days or less. A critical procedural instruction is that Kasino must not be physically mixed with other medications in the same solution, requiring separate administration. Dose adjustments are mandated for patients with impaired renal function, who typically receive a normal loading dose followed by a reduced maintenance dose or an extended interval.

Recent Clinical Evidence

Research evidence / Overview of Studies for Kasino

The research on Kasino (Amikacin sulfate) focuses on its evaluation in severe bacterial infections, particularly when standard treatments are insufficient or when the bacteria show resistance to multiple drugs. The evidence base primarily consists of studies that assess short-term outcomes in hospitalized patients and long-term observational data for chronic conditions. Research provides context but not individual predictions, and study results reflect the specific conditions under which they were conducted.


Evidence for Use in Serious Systemic Bacterial Infections

Research into Kasino's role in acute, life-threatening conditions like septicemia (blood poisoning) and severe pneumonia primarily involved short-term comparative clinical studies. These studies were designed to assess endpoints such as the resolution of infection signs and the clearance of the infecting bacteria, alongside tracking patterns related to mortality within the acute treatment period. These trials often studied Kasino as a combination therapy alongside other antibiotics. Findings describe patterns observed in the studies related to how infection signs evolved and patient outcomes when Amikacin-containing regimens were evaluated. What remains uncertain is the specific contribution of Kasino when used in combination therapies, as the reported outcomes often reflect the combined action of all antibiotics used in the regimen.


Evidence for Use in Multi-Drug Resistant Tuberculosis

For multi-drug resistant tuberculosis (MDR-TB), a condition where the bacteria are resistant to standard first-line treatments, the evidence primarily comes from large-scale observational cohort studies and data collected by large-scale public health observation programs. These long-term studies explored the outcomes of complex multi-drug regimens in which Kasino was observed, monitoring treatment duration and the rates of sputum culture conversion (when the bacteria were no longer found in sputum samples). The major limitation is that the data are derived from regimens using many drugs simultaneously, which complicates efforts to isolate the specific contribution of Kasino within the total treatment strategy.


Evidence for Use in Complicated Localized Infections

Studies have also explored Kasino's application in complicated localized infections. Research in this area includes randomized comparative trials that examined Kasino against other treatments. The research examined outcomes related to physical discomfort and acute changes, measuring the clearance of the pathogen from the specific site of infection, such as urine. However, the evidence quality varies across studies, as the research is heterogeneous across the wide variety of localized infections.


Long-Term Outcomes and Extended Follow-up Studies

Across the various indications, the bulk of the regulatory evidence focuses on the immediate or short-term effects observed during the acute phase of treatment—typically the first 7 to 30 days. There is limited information for long-term outcomes that describes the durability of the reported observations or the recurrence of infections over the course of many months or years.


Evidence in Special Populations and Subgroups

Research has explored Kasino in various patient groups. Studies examined both pediatric populations and older adults admitted to hospital settings. For these special populations, research describes patterns related to patient outcomes observed across different age and disease states. However, sample sizes were modest in some subgroup studies, and data for certain groups, such as pregnant or breastfeeding individuals, or those with specific co-existing illnesses (comorbidities), remain insufficient for a comprehensive understanding of treatment outcomes.

Frequently Asked Questions (FAQ)

Common questions about Kasino (FAQ)


Q: What are the most commonly reported mild side effects of Kasino?

While regulatory documents focus on key safety risks like kidney and inner ear damage, less severe adverse reactions have also been reported. According to official product information, these may include a headache, skin rash, mild nausea or vomiting, loss of appetite, and reactions occurring at the injection site.


Q: Does Kasino interact with common over-the-counter pain relievers?

Official interaction guidelines note that Kasino is known to interact with certain medications, including some non-steroidal anti-inflammatory drugs (NSAIDs). Because of this, patient information advises that the use of any non-prescription pain relievers should be discussed with a healthcare professional before taking them.


Q: Is it normal to feel slightly nauseous when first starting Kasino?

Nausea and vomiting are listed among the potential adverse reactions of Kasino (Amikacin sulfate) in official regulatory documentation. Experiencing these symptoms is documented as a possible side effect of the medicine.


Q: What are the ingredients in Kasino besides the active component?

The active ingredient in this medicine is Amikacin sulfate. Official labeling also notes the possible presence of sulfites (like sodium metabisulfite) as inactive components. Sulfites are highlighted because they have the potential to cause allergic reactions in susceptible individuals.


Q: Is there a known effect of Kasino on mood or emotional state?

The primary safety profile focuses on potential neurological disorders like tremor or paresthesia. However, certain adverse reaction reports have included changes in emotional state, such as depression and irritability. Official sources often categorize these effects as having an unknown or rare incidence.


Q: Can taking other supplements or vitamins interfere with Kasino?

Official guidance emphasizes the need for caution when Kasino is used with other products. Because certain vitamins and supplements may contain ingredients that could affect the drug's action or potential toxicity, patient information states that all supplements and vitamins should be discussed with a healthcare provider.


Q: Is Kasino a commonly available drug or is it specialized?

Official sources and essential medicine lists describe Kasino as a medication generally reserved for short-term use in serious bacterial infections, particularly when standard treatments are not working. This indicates that it is utilized for specialized, often severe, conditions rather than being a commonly available first-line drug.


Q: Does Kasino affect blood pressure or heart rate?

Official adverse reaction profiles list hypotension (low blood pressure) as a potential side effect of Kasino. The regulatory documentation does not typically provide specific information regarding the drug's effect on heart rate.


Q: How quickly should I expect to notice anything after starting Kasino?

Pharmacokinetic studies indicate that peak blood concentrations are reached quickly, within about one hour of administration. This allows the active ingredient to begin reaching necessary concentrations. Official clinical data note that bacteria sensitive to the drug typically show a response within 24 to 48 hours of starting treatment.


Q: Does Kasino affect sleep or cause drowsiness?

Drowsiness and lethargy are listed as potential adverse reactions in official drug information for Kasino. While this is not listed as a common effect, it is a documented possibility.


Q: Is it necessary to avoid specific foods or drinks while taking Kasino?

Official patient guidelines recommend consulting a healthcare professional regarding the concurrent use of the medicine with food, alcohol, or tobacco. This discussion is mentioned in regulatory sources due to the potential for certain interactions that may affect the drug's safety or action.


Q: Is Kasino a brand name or a generic medicine?

Kasino is a proprietary name, while the active medicine itself is Amikacin Sulfate, which is a generic drug. Regulatory and authoritative sources list Amikacin Sulfate as the generic name, with 'Amikin' also being a common brand name.


Q: If Kasino causes dry mouth, is there a simple explanation for why?

Official regulatory documents list dry mouth as a potential adverse reaction of the drug. The appearance of this symptom is noted because dry mouth is a reported adverse reaction of the medicine.


Q: Can Kasino change the results of routine lab tests?

Official safety information indicates that the key risk of kidney damage (nephrotoxicity) is monitored by observing changes in routine lab tests. These changes include an increase in serum creatinine and abnormal findings in urine content.


Q: How long does Kasino stay in the system after the last intake?

In patients with normal kidney function, official pharmacological data indicates the mean half-life of the drug is about two hours. The administered dose is largely eliminated from the body, with nearly 98% excreted unchanged in the urine within 24 hours of administration.


Q: Why is Kasino not recommended for people with certain heart conditions?

While not a formal contraindication, studies referenced in authoritative literature suggest that pre-existing health issues, including certain heart conditions, are risk factors that have been associated with an increased potential for kidney injury during treatment with this type of medication.


Q: Does Kasino affect the ability to drive or operate machinery?

Official regulatory summaries include warnings that the medicine may cause neurotoxicity, leading to symptoms like dizziness, loss of balance, or vertigo. These symptoms can certainly impair a person's ability to drive or operate complex machinery safely.


Q: Does Kasino interact with alcohol?

Official patient information states that the use of alcohol should be discussed with a healthcare professional while taking Kasino. This discussion is mentioned in regulatory sources due to potential risks.


Q: Is it possible to develop a tolerance to Kasino over time?

To maintain the effectiveness of this medicine, official regulatory documentation emphasizes using it only for infections caused by susceptible bacteria. This strict use is intended to reduce the development of drug-resistant bacteria, which is the mechanism described in regulatory documentation.


Q: How is Kasino typically eliminated from the body?

Official pharmacological data confirms that the medicine is not metabolized by the body. Nearly the entire dose is excreted unchanged, primarily through the urine by a process called glomerular filtration.

How should Kasino be stored and disposed of?

The official labeling for Kasino (Amikacin sulfate) dictates specific storage and disposal rules to maintain product stability and ensure safety.

Official Storage Conditions

Labeled Storage Temperature Requirements: Store at Controlled Room Temperature (CRT), 20 C to 25 C (68 F to 77 F) [Source: FDA DailyMed].
Handling/Prohibited Environments: Do not freeze the solution, and avoid exposure to excessive heat.
Stability after Dilution (IV use): The prepared solution is stable for 24 hours at room temperature or for extended periods when refrigerated, according to specific manufacturer instructions.
Child-Protection Storage: The medicine must be stored out of the reach of children, as required by regulatory agencies.

Disposal Requirements

Official disposal guidelines for unused or expired Kasino recommend discarding the product through an authorized drug take-back program. The product should not be flushed down a toilet or disposed of in household trash unless otherwise instructed by a healthcare professional or specific local regulation. Discarding of medical waste must adhere to local institutional procedures for pharmaceutical waste.
